Project Superintendent
4 weeks ago
Our Project Superintendent's manage and coordinate all on-site construction activities of subcontractors, suppliers, and Rice Companies personnel, to ensure highest quality control, safety practices, maintain on-time scheduling and budgeting. This position may require the individual to be traveling to in-state and out-of-state job sites on a regular basis.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Records and submits daily project report of all subcontractors, suppliers or Rice Companies assigned work. Consult Daily Reporting SOP for more info/direction.
Maintains construction schedule to include four (4) week look ahead, identifies and solves problems, maintains estimated budget, insures quality workmanship conforming to original project plans/specifications, identifies risks and resolves within guidelines established by Rice Companies and Project Managers.
Orders incidentals and stores or stages proactively to have ready for Rice Companies labor.
Schedules and documents inspections, as necessary, in collaboration with Project Manager and subcontractors.
Builds and maintains effective relationships with owners, customers, inspectors, subcontractors, suppliers, and other Rice Companies employees.
Promotes job site safety, encourages safe work practices, documents and rectifies job site hazards immediately.
Maintains a clean and organized job site, including job site construction office.
Verifies current drawings are being utilized by Rice Companies labor and all subcontractors.
QUALIFICATIONS
Five (5) years of progressively responsible, broad-based, commercial construction experience including pertinent demonstrated construction leadership experience
OSHA 10 Certification
SWPPP Certification
Equipment certifications (scissor lift, forklifts, boom lifts, skid steer, etc.)
Demonstrated proficiency of construction tools and equipment, including but not limited to saws, drills, levels, transits, hand tools, etc.
Demonstrated ability to read and interpret plans/prints
Self-starter, highly motivated and goal-oriented individual with leadership skills
Possess ability to schedule and multi-task in a Microsoft Office environment
Working knowledge of both State/Federal Building Codes
Occasional lifting of over 50 pounds without assistance
Overnight travel will be required
